COMMENTARY
DIRECTORS` STATEMENT
The directors take pleasure in presenting the unaudited interim results of the
Group for the six months ended 30 June 2009.
BASIS OF PRESENTATION
The Group`s interim financial statements for the six months ended 30 June 2009
have been prepared in terms of International Financial Reporting
Standards("IFRS") in compliance with IAS34: Interim Financial Reporting. The
accounting policies used in preparing the interim financial statements were
consistent with those applied in the 2008 Annual Financial Statements and are in
accordance with IFRS.
REVIEW OF RESULTS
The performance for the period reflects the results of the group`s 24,9%
interest in Kaya FM and administrative expenses incurred in relation to head
office activities. The administrative expenses include R1,8 million in respect
of the Primedia/Capricorn and Odd Lot offers referred to in more detail below.
A dividend of 15 cents per share was declared to shareholders registered on 13
February 2009, the total amount of the dividend (including STC thereon) was
R20,342 million, and largely accounted for the significant decrease in the cash
balance and the related interest income in the period.
PRIMEDIA (PTY) LTD ("Primedia")/ CAPRICORN CAPITAL PARTNERS (PTY) LTD
("Capricorn") OFFER
The full details of the offer to NAIL shareholders to acquire their shares in
NAIL were released on the Securities Exchange News Service ("SENS") on 23
February 2009.
The offer was the culmination of the process which began with a SENS
announcement released on 17 December 2004 in terms of which NAIL shareholders
were advised of Primedia`s firm intention to acquire all of the NAIL ordinary
and "N" ordinary shares ("Nail Shares") for a price of 15,1 cents per share. In
terms of the offer, the price would increase monthly by 0.0967 cents per share
from 1 April 2005. The resultant prior offer price taking into account the
monthly increase as well as cash on the NAIL balance sheet would have amounted
to 24.3 cents per NAIL share.
Subsequent to the announcement, Capricorn joined the Primedia as a joint offeror
(collectively the "Offerors"). Implementation of this offer was however delayed
due to Competition issues which were finally resolved and the relevant
Competition approvals have been received in favour of Primedia and Capricorn.
NAIL announced on 23 February 2008 that it had been informed by the Offerors
that they had acquired NAIL shares for an initial price of 26 cents per NAIL
share, plus an attributable portion of a potential agterskot related to
outstanding tax claims, details of which are set out more fully below.
A mandatory offer was extended to all remaining shareholders in terms of Rule
8.1 of the Securities Regulation Code on Takeovers and Mergers. Subsequent to
the implementation of this offer, the Offerors held the following interest in
NAIL:
NAIL "N" shares NAIL ordinary shares
Number of % Holding Number of % Holding
shares shares
Capricorn 31,922,801 26.10% 2,080,519 49.90%
Primedia 90,159,978 73.50% 1,964,184 47.10%
TAX CLAIMS
The agterskot, if any, will be determined by reference to the outcome of certain
tax issues being resolved, namely, the balance of NAIL`s claim against the South
African Revenue Service ("SARS") for income tax overpayments and the claim by
NAIL`s former subsidiary company, KFM Radio (Pty) Ltd ("KFM") for the recovery
of tax overpayments made following the disallowance of its trademark write off
in terms of Section 11 (gA) of the Income Tax Act.
Judgment was handed down in the Tax Court on 11 May 2009, in the matter of the
disallowed KFM trade mark deduction. The court found that KFM was entitled to
claim a deduction for the R50 million cost incurred in acquiring the KFM
trademarks in terms of Section 11(gA) of the Act. However, the South Africa
Revenue Services ("SARS") was granted discretion to determine the write-off
period of the trade mark deduction allowed. Revised assessments have not yet
been issued by SARS as the write-off of period has not yet been settled.
Assuming that the tax claims are settled in favour of NAIL/KFM, the additional
agterskot related to these tax claims could amount to 30,4 cents per share.
ODD LOT OFFER
An Odd Lot offer was made to NAIL shareholders who held 30 or less NAIL shares
at the close of business on 29 May 2009. The result of the Odd Lot offer was as
follows:
NAIL "N" shares NAIL ordinary shares
Number of Value Number of Value R
shares R shares
Elected/deemed 110,594 75,204 26,875 18,275
to sell
Elected to 222 144
retain
Consequently the "N" share register was reduced by 20 356 (90.9%) shareholders
and the ordinary share register by 3 846 (88.7%) shareholders.
